I hate to bring up old thread but this one bother me. As some of you know I have a Doxa Military Edition that has been running + 15 second daily for almost 8 months. four days ago I adjusted the timing , for the last three days it it has been keeping accuracy of plus or minus 0, I just wanted +5 got lucky. What really bothers me is this statement that I didn't believe at the time, and verified when I peaked inside the Doxa Mil Ed "I have been told by DOXA, in writing that the movements in the Non-COSC and COSC are exactly the same. The only difference is the Dial, and the COSC Paperwork. " http://forums.watchuseek.com/showthread.php?p=65143&mode=linear#post65143 Not true it's a eta 2824-2, but not a chronometer grade movement The spokes are straight Eric Avery posted a picture of the Doxa chronometer grade movement a while back and the spoke flare.
